    That's a bit of a loaded question; the differences are plenty; but if you mean; are they prototypically accurate for all roads offered the answer; like with the Kato's is "no"....

    The Rapido cars are miles and miles ahead of any n scale passenger car I've seen or own (and that's a lot) for detail and prototypical accuracy. They are "dead ringers" for CN cars; very close to others. Their detail is amazing; right down to separately applied underside details and car number boards in vestibule windows.

    Kato made a good model; and for it's day it was the gold standard. They knew they had a winner and slapped the paint on for a large number of roads ...... their models were, in some cases 100% accurate to the prototype; but in most cases; they were way, way off..... no fault of anyone's just the facts....you can't make one car for 10 roads....

    Rapido made a better model.... 15 year later; new technology; new expectations; and a crazy and prototypically driven owner (Yep Jason; I said crazy... you crawl under locomotives with a camera and sketch pad..........) Great cars, but are they 100% accurate for each livery offered....NO.

    The minor variations by mfg's and roads make it impossible for anyone to make 100% accurate cars for 10-12 roads in one mold..... so you get one or two roads 100% and the rest are in the "close but no cigar" category.....I don't care if they are perfect; I bought Kato's......

    The Rapido cars are, IMHO, the new gold standard for passenger car and they will get better; this is the first release. Are they perfect - no... MT coupler issues and livery fidelity are always going to crop up on first runs; they will fix these issues but these are the new "bar setter" in my mind for passenger equipment.
